The ISO 9660 format is commonly used in the Windows world for CD images, and Apple was sensible enough to support .iso files in Mac OS X's Disk Utility. But what if you need to use a file created by a Windows application that doesn't comply with the standard? That's where iat comes in.

iat 0.1.3 is a Mac port of the open source iat that converts BIN, MDF, PDI, CDI, NRG, B5I, and other CD image formats to ISO-9660.
